What Type A and Type B mean
Type A
Violations of licensing requirements that, if not corrected, have a direct and immediate ris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.
Type B
Violations of licensing requirements that, without correction, could become a ris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.

Both classifications are published by California CDSS and are shown as published. SeniorLivingFacts does not rename them or add a severity level of its own.

Fire safety and emergency preparednessType B
Official classification
Type B
Official code
1569.695(c)
Regulation authority
HSC

What the official deficiency says

(c) A facility shall conduct a drill at least quarterly for each shift. The type of emergency covered in a drill shall vary from quarter to quarter, taking into account different emergency scenarios. An actual evacuation of residents is not required during a drill. While a facility may provide an opportunity for residents to participate in a drill, it shall not require any resident participation. Documentation of the drills shall include the date, the type of emergency covered by the drill, and the names of staff participating in the drill.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Deficient Practice Statement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in ensuring that the required disaster drill is conducted on each shift no less than quarterly which po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

Official plan of correction

POC Due Date: 09/11/2026 Plan of Correction Administrator to conduct a required disaster drill on all shifts and submit it along with a self certification that facility understands that drills shall be conducted on every shift no less than quarterly to CCL by POC due date 09/11/2026.
